Responsibilities
- Supervises shift coverage and coordinates breaks for team members.
- Ensures team members maintain knowledge of the menu and any specials being offered.
- Provides updates of any changes to the menu.
- Supervises the team in maintaining a clean and presentable work area.
- Ensures the venues are stocked and prepared for service at all times.
- Complies and ensures compliance with liquor laws regarding alcohol service where applicable.
- Complies with all departmental food and franchise contractual agreements.
- Conducts end of shift reports for cashiers on shift.
- Coordinates troubleshooting technical problems with Point of Sale (POS) system, facilities, equipment etc., and contacts with appropriate support, as necessary.
- Provides ongoing supervision and mentoring to team members.
- Monitors product quality and ensures a high level of guest service.
- Coordinates in the on-going coaching and mentoring of team as directed by department management.
- Must maintain excellent attendance and be available to work events and varied schedules per business need.
